 Neil asks, does anyone remember his dad Brian Ramsbottom?

If you do remember Brian, please leave a comment!



Hello,

My father the subject was a BT engineer for many years, starting as an apprentice in the GPO around the early 70s.

He was left the company around ten years ago for medical reasons and has since development dementia.

I am curious to know if any of his former colleagues remember him or have any stories about him.

I know he used to work in 'Central' in Manchester city centre and a place I think was called 'Manchester F' in the 90s. He worked as a transmission engineer and was all over the place.

I remember he went to a place called 'Stone' for training courses when I was a child.

If you know of anybody or have the capacity to ask your members if they remember him, I would like to get in touch. I'd like to know more about my fathers career, but he cannot remember to tell me.

3 From: Ian Clayton Posted: 19-09-2025
I remember Brian. When I was on transmission planning he worked on the outer Manchester construction staff. Was a very knowledgeable bloke and really helpful. Sort of guy who I could just tell what I needed doing and he would go off and work out what stores he needed me to order and how many hours he needed to do the job. Made my life as a planner very easy. Think he use to have an office Store room on the 1st floor of Droylsden exchange.

He ended up in the transition centre probably about 2006 07 from memory maybe earlier. Last time I saw him was outside Hyde exchange probably about 2010 Although not certain He use to garage a car there and it had a PC and several mobiles phones in the boot. Told me he use to get given routes to drive and the phones use to record the signal strength as he drove so they could work out weak signal spots and I presume someone would investigate further if they should install a new mast. After that I think he ended up on Openreach working out of Altrincham on the diagnostics team but again not certain.
